NOUMEA NORTH ENTRANCE

The issue of new urban planning for the entrance to Nouméa is the requalification of the northern entrance to Nouméa in terms of both urban planning and public spaces.

The aim is to reconcile the north of the city with its center, while facilitating new pedestrian, commercial and cultural activities. It is also about preparing for future changes in Nouméa.
